Summary

The Integrated Care Fund aims to support a range of integrated health and social care services for adults of all ages, including those with long-term health conditions and multiple health problems. The Funding Priorities are:

  • Early intervention and prevention
  • Addressing mental health and addictions 
  • Improving unscheduled care and optimising intermediate care
  • Support for none commissioned carers e.g. carers support groups

They expect your project to meet at least one of the 9 National Health and Wellbeing Outcomes outlined by the Scottish Government:

  1. People can look after and improve their own health and wellbeing and live in good health for longer.
  2. People, including those with disabilities or long-term conditions, or who are frail, can live, as far as reasonably practicable, independently and at home or in a homely setting in their community.
  3. People who use health and social care services have positive experiences of those services, and have their dignity respected.
  4. Health and social care services are centred on helping to maintain or improve the quality of life of people who use those services.
  5. Health and social care services contribute to reducing health inequalities.
  6. People who provide unpaid care are supported to look after their own health and wellbeing, including to reduce any negative impact of their caring role on their own health and well-being.
  7. People who use health and social care services are safe from harm.
  8. People who work in health and social care services feel engaged with the work they do and are supported to continuously improve the information, support, care and treatment they provide.
  9. Resources are used effectively and efficiently in the provision of health and social care services.
